What Are Wwise RTPCs?
Wwise RTPCs are tools that allow game developers to control audio parameters in real-time. By linking RTPCs to game variables, such as health, developers can modify sounds dynamically, creating a more responsive audio environment.
Implementing RTPCs for Player Health
To use RTPCs for player health, follow these steps:
- Define a game parameter that tracks the player’s health.
- Create an RTPC in Wwise and link it to the health parameter.
- Set the range of the RTPC to correspond to the player’s health values.
- Assign the RTPC to control specific audio parameters, such as volume, pitch, or filter effects.
Example: Low Health Warning
For instance, when the player’s health drops below 20%, you can trigger a distorted or intense sound to alert the player. As health decreases, the RTPC modulates the audio parameters accordingly, increasing tension.
Benefits of Using RTPCs for Dynamic Audio
Using RTPCs provides several advantages:
- Creates a more immersive experience by adapting sounds to gameplay.
- Provides immediate audio feedback, enhancing player awareness.
- Reduces the need for multiple pre-recorded sound variations.
